Haven't seen this situation on the messageboard yet. I have all my power
options tunred "OFF". For some reason, my brand new desktop, running Windows
Vista Home Premium, shows me a message saying it's entering power save, and
then it shuts down - in the middle of whatever I'm doing. I have all the
drivers updated, but haven't done anything with the BIOS. I'm pretty new to
all this stuff. Any suggestions on why power save comes on by itself and how
I can prevent it? Also, if I manually turn the computer to "Sleep", sometimes
it will wake back up when I want it to, and sometimes it won't, forcing me to
turn the on/off button and reboot that way. Thanks for any help.
